Documentation is the recording of all information, both objective and subjective, in the clinical record
communications of the resident involving care and treatments. It has legal requirements regarding accuracy and completeness, legibility and timing.
Special forms in the clinical record are utilized in nursing documentation, such as assessment, care plan, nursing progress notes, flow sheets, medication sheets, incident reports, and summary sheets (daily, weekly, monthly, discharge).
Documentation also occurs in the clinical software Point Click Care(PCC).GoalThe facility will maintain complete and accurate documentation for each resident on all appropriate clinical record sheets.

Source: This inspection report was downloaded directly from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) via Medicare.gov. CMS releases nursing home inspection reports in bulk. The findings reflect what state surveyors documented in the official Form CMS-2567 Statement of Deficiencies on the date of the inspection.
Plan of correction not included: The CMS report we receive does not include the facility's plan of correction. Facilities submit plans of correction separately to their state survey agency and those responses may not appear in CMS public data at the time of release. The absence of a plan of correction in this report does not mean one was not filed. Readers who want information about corrective steps taken by the facility are encouraged to contact the facility or their state survey agency directly.
